Understanding Your AC Installation Options

Selecting the right air conditioning system for your Westminster home involves evaluating multiple factors including your home’s square footage, insulation quality, window placement, and existing ductwork configuration. Central air conditioning systems remain the most popular choice for homeowners, offering whole-house cooling through a network of ducts that distribute conditioned air evenly throughout living spaces. These systems typically consist of an outdoor condensing unit containing the compressor and condenser coil, paired with an indoor evaporator coil installed near your furnace.

For homes without existing ductwork or those seeking zone-specific cooling control, ductless mini-split systems present an excellent alternative. These systems feature individual air handlers mounted in different rooms, each connected to an outdoor unit through refrigerant lines that require only a small hole in the exterior wall. This configuration allows for customized temperature control in different areas of your home while eliminating the energy losses associated with traditional ductwork, which can account for up to thirty percent of cooling energy consumption in typical installations.

The Installation Process and Technical Considerations

Professional AC installation begins with a comprehensive load calculation to determine the appropriate system size for your Westminster home. This calculation considers factors including ceiling height, insulation R-values, window specifications, and local climate data specific to the 80031 and surrounding zip codes. An oversized system will cycle on and off frequently, failing to properly dehumidify your indoor air while consuming excessive energy. Conversely, an undersized system will run continuously without achieving desired comfort levels, leading to premature wear and increased utility costs.

During installation, our technicians ensure proper refrigerant line sizing and insulation, critical factors that directly impact system efficiency and longevity. The refrigerant lines connecting indoor and outdoor units must be properly brazed to prevent leaks, evacuated to remove moisture and contaminants, and charged with the precise amount of refrigerant specified by the manufacturer. We also verify that electrical connections meet National Electrical Code requirements, including proper circuit breaker sizing and disconnect switch installation for safe system operation and maintenance access.

Energy Efficiency Standards and Technology Advancements

Modern air conditioning systems available for Westminster homes incorporate advanced technologies that significantly reduce energy consumption compared to units manufactured even ten years ago. The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io, commonly known as SEER, measures cooling output relative to energy input over an entire cooling season. Current federal regulations require minimum SEER ratings of fourteen for new installations, while high-efficiency models achieve ratings exceeding twenty, potentially reducing cooling costs by forty percent or more compared to older systems.

Variable-speed compressor technology represents another significant advancement in AC system design. Unlike traditional single-stage compressors that operate at full capacity whenever running, variable-speed units adjust their output to match actual cooling demands. This modulation capability allows the system to maintain more consistent temperatures while consuming less energy, particularly during mild weather conditions when full cooling capacity isn’t required. Additionally, these systems provide superior humidity control by running at lower speeds for extended periods rather than cycling frequently at full capacity.

Installation Requirements Specific to Westminster

Westminster’s elevation of approximately 5,400 feet above sea level creates unique considerations for AC installation that our experienced team addresses with every project. The reduced air density at this altitude affects both system performance and installation procedures. Air conditioning systems must work harder to achieve the same cooling effect due to decreased heat transfer efficiency, making proper sizing and installation even more critical for optimal performance.

Local building codes and permit requirements also factor into the installation process. Westminster requires permits for AC installations to ensure compliance with safety standards and energy codes. Our team handles all permit applications and coordinates required inspections, streamlining the installation process while ensuring full compliance with municipal regulations. We also consider factors unique to Colorado’s climate, such as protecting outdoor units from hail damage and ensuring proper drainage to prevent ice formation during shoulder seasons when temperatures fluctuate significantly.

Maximizing Long-Term Performance

Proper AC installation extends beyond simply connecting equipment according to manufacturer specifications. We focus on system optimization strategies that enhance performance throughout your air conditioner’s operational life. This includes:

  • Ductwork evaluation and sealing: identifying and addressing leaks that waste cooled air
  • Thermostat placement optimization: ensuring accurate temperature readings for efficient operation
  • Airflow balancing: adjusting dampers and registers for even cooling distribution
  • Condensate drainage design: preventing water damage and maintaining indoor air quality
